0

タイトルの通り、Facebookでログインしているユーザーとメールでログインしているユーザーを区別する方法を教えてください。私はdjango-facebookを使用しています。

のようだ

 request.user.is_authenticated()

あらゆる種類の認証用です。

どんな助けでも大歓迎です、

4

1 に答える 1

1

request.user にFacebookProfileがあるかどうかを確認できると思います:

{% if request.user.facebookprofile %}user has facebook profile{% endif %}

またはPythonで:

if request.user.facebookprofile_id:
    print 'has facebookprofile'
于 2012-10-24T13:03:36.933 に答える